January 8
3 Events
- 1198 - Innocent III becomes Pope.
- 1867 - African American men granted the right to vote in the District of Columbia.
- 1962 - Leonardo da Vinci's Mona Lisa is exhibited in the United States for the first time (National Gallery of Art in Washington, D.C.).
2 Births
- 1935 - Elvis Presley, American singer and guitarist (d. 1977)
- 1911 - Butterfly McQueen, American actress (d. 1995)
1 Holiday
- Commonwealth Day is celebrated in the Northern Mariana Islands.
